#127906 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#127906 is composed of 7.1% red, 47.5%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 95% yellow and 52.5% black. It has a hue angle of 113.7 degrees, a saturation of 90.6% and a lightness of 24.9%. #127906 color hex could be obtained by blending #24f20c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#127906

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010900 is the darkest color, while #f6fff5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#127906

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d433c is the less saturated color, while #0e7e01 is the most saturated one.
